2019 Growing Season

 In Blog

2019 started off a very difficult planting season as the farm experienced 16″ of rain in 6 weeks. This made planting a tough task. We were able to plant 4200 trees. They were made up of Fraser Fir, Balsam Fir, Concolor Fir, Canaan Fir, Black Hills Spruce, White pine and Scotch pine. The wet spring made for a heavy dose of weeds the remainder of the year. Trees were sheared in summer and were provided multiple applications of fertilizer. The field work of mowing is starting to slow down and our attention will turn to the Christmas tree sales season. Every year we try and build on the previous year and this year is no exception as we will be adding innovative wreath designs like horse heads, improving garland display and sizing choices, and finally painting some trees for sale with colors like white, pink and blue.
